Client:
William W. Creighton Youth Services
Problem:
Connect 8 facilities
and offices located throughout Thunder Bay and across Northwestern Ontario
into one secure network that allows access to critical
applications and sensitive documents.
Solution:
In early 2004 William W. Creighton
Youth Services was starting to find their network outdated and didn't
compare with the current and emerging technologies. They had very little
connectivity between their facilities.
and each facility was using a stand-alone copy of their key database
application. This system
was bulky, not very efficient and made routine maintenance difficult.
To solve this problem TBayIT installed two new servers, both running
Microsoft Windows 2003 Server and one to run Citrix Metaframe Server
XP. Key network components were also upgraded to increase speeds and
make for a better experience with each end-user. Now with the power and
reliability of Citrix and Microsoft Windows Server 2003, all of Creighton
Youth's facilities can now log in to the
main network, run the critical applications, and transfer files securely.
System Highlights:
Two Powerful
Servers running Windows Server 2003
Citrix MetaFrame
XP to distribute critical applications and files through a secure internet
connection
Automated Tape
Backup System
Custom developed
Intranet calendars to manage appointments and internal events
Network Antivirus
Services to protect valuable data
